What role is the army playing in this election?

According to King’s College London’s Ayesha Siddiqa, Pakistan’s army wants a weak coalition to form under PMLN leadership.

“In a way, these are the results we got,” Siddiqa said. “But I’d argue that these aren’t the results they expected. They did everything to make sure voter turnout was low, but people showed up passionately.”

Shehbaz Sharif, Bilawal Bhutto Zardari, or Nawaz Sharif would probably lead a coalition government together, according to Siddiqa.

Pakistan’s powerful military establishment has ruled directly for more than three decades.

According to the analyst, the PMLN has a lead in Punjab, the country’s most populous province, so it will safely form government there.
